What we do

Active Families, Active Lives is for children and young people, aged 2-18 years old, in Cardiff and Vale who wish to receive support in managing their weight and health. The team works in an empowering and nurturing way to help families feel safe and secure.
Active Families, Active Lives (AFAL) works in a holistic way to understand you, your child and family’s needs. We work in a non-judgemental, empathetic and supportive manner.

After we receive your referral you will be sent a letter inviting you to contact us to make an appointment.

First appointment
Every child, young person and family entering the AFAL service will have an initial assessment appointment.
Before this appointment we will ask you to complete an initial assessment form. Please complete as much as you can before the appointment and bring it with you.
We will use this appointment to get to know you and your family.
We will also take some measurements for a physical assessment.
